Transaction 75142241678c8fc9fbead1b2993bebc29becfd347f6ab67d1471608b6fca3bd4
1 Input
1 Output
-
75142241678c8fc9fbead1b2993bebc29becfd347f6ab67d1471608b6fca3bd4:0
- value
- 2504513
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e2c2ffd0c46a6f3fe50ed7236a70f35f8a79146
- address
- bc1qpckzllgvg6n08ljsa4erdfc0xhu20y2xp7v2dy